Virtual Server 2005 SP1 Beta and a whole lot more
Steve Ballmer today announced a bunch of stuff today related to Microsoft’s virtualization roadmap including:
- Virtual Server 2005 SP1 Beta
- Microsoft will be looking to 3rd parties to provide support for non Microsoft OSes under Virtual Server 2005
- A new MOM 2005 management pack for Virtual Server 2005
- Microsoft will license royalty-free the Virtual Hard Disk (VHD) file format
All of this is great news.
Some highlights in what’s new in VS2005 SP1 Beta:
- Support for Windows 2003 SP1 Guests (right now if you’ve tried I’m sure you’ve found performance suffers)
- Support for x64 hosts (guests will still be limited to 32-bit OSes)
